diff options
| author | Jason Sams <rjsams@android.com> | 2010-08-18 12:38:03 -0700 |
|---|---|---|
| committer | Jason Sams <rjsams@android.com> | 2010-08-18 12:38:03 -0700 |
| commit | d0cb106ff27d535365215ac3830c67239c7b5ced (patch) | |
| tree | dd0cc7cc7bb5e312388a22c7fa05a4def54fcd43 /libs/rs/rsContext.cpp | |
| parent | d78be37d81f6c1aba75180c7608753a027a881ee (diff) | |
| download | frameworks_base-d0cb106ff27d535365215ac3830c67239c7b5ced.zip frameworks_base-d0cb106ff27d535365215ac3830c67239c7b5ced.tar.gz frameworks_base-d0cb106ff27d535365215ac3830c67239c7b5ced.tar.bz2 | |
Fix bug looping non-blocking fifos.
Change-Id: I33dcf575466bfef672af4e113ad692397b5213e9
Diffstat (limited to 'libs/rs/rsContext.cpp')
| -rw-r--r-- | libs/rs/rsContext.cpp | 2 |
1 files changed, 1 insertions, 1 deletions
diff --git a/libs/rs/rsContext.cpp b/libs/rs/rsContext.cpp index 1a7c5ad..08dd57b 100644 --- a/libs/rs/rsContext.cpp +++ b/libs/rs/rsContext.cpp @@ -744,7 +744,7 @@ bool Context::sendMessageToClient(void *data, uint32_t cmdID, size_t len, bool w return false; } if (!waitForSpace) { - if (mIO.mToClient.getFreeSpace() <= (len + 8)) { + if (!mIO.mToClient.makeSpaceNonBlocking(len + 8)) { // Not enough room, and not waiting. return false; } |
